John Jinapor backs calls for construction of road leading to Savannah Diamond Cement company

The Member of Parliament for the Yapei Kusawgu Constituency, John Abdulai Jinapor, has actually included his voice to require the building and construction of the roadway resulting in the Buipe Savannah Diamond Cement Company Ltd.

Mr. Jinapor made the call after he led a group of the town’s leaders, consisting of the District Chief Executive, to a closed-door conference with the management of the business on Friday.

The roadway from the Buipe Tamale Highway extends to the Savannah local capital, Damongo. It connects rural neighborhoods such as Old Buipe, Lito, Sor 1, Sor 2, and others to Damongo, a roadway the federal government has actually assured to build for several years.

The Buipe Savannah Diamond Cement Company Ltd is 6.5 km far from the Buipe Tamale Highway.

Regardless of its financial value to the business, the district, and the nation as a whole due to the activities of the business and others, the roadway remains in an awful state, making it challenging for vehicle drivers and locals of the neighborhood to utilize it.

It has actually ended up being a significant source of dust in the dry season, adding to the health threat for citizens.

To have actually the roadway repaired, the youth have actually been agitating and are preparing to start a serene presentation versus the cement business for overlooking the roadway.

They compete that the business has the obligation to repair the roadway as a business social obligation.

After an engagement with the management of the business, the MP for the location, John Abdulai Jinapor, has actually turned to the federal government to build the roadway.

Mr. Jinapor highlighted the right of the youth of the location to show for the federal government to repair the roadway within the law.
